Report: Arsenal leading race for AC Milan midfielder Franck Kessie

AC Milan may be forced to cash in on Franck Kessie this summer, with Arsenal reportedly leading the way for the Ivory Coast international.

Arsenal are the frontrunners to sign Franck Kessie as the midfielder enters the final year of his AC Milan contract, according to a report.

The Ivory Coast international started 36 times in Milan's successful Serie A campaign last time out, playing a big part in the Rossoneri's second-placed finish.

However, the Italian side may be forced to sell Kessie this summer due to financial concerns.

La Gazzetta dello Sport claims that Milan are confident that they can still land £42m for the 24-year-old, despite only having 12 months to run on his deal.

Arsenal are said to lead the way for Kessie's signature, two years after first showing an interest in the central midfielder.
